Quick start for Feedgrader, our podcast feed validator. Clone the repo, run make bootstrap, then run the fixture suite before reviewing any parser changes. Validation hits the internal Episodic metadata service, so stub it in unit tests but use the live endpoint for integration runs. The key for that service is below.

service key, fawip-bajef: kto11_Qt5wZK9vdNC

# Orphaned-resource sweeper (Brushclear) env config.
# New folks: read before editing.
# SWEEP_INTERVAL_MIN controls scan cadence; keep >= 15 in prod.
# DRY_RUN=1 means nothing gets deleted — flip to 0 only after a reviewed dry run.
# GRACE_HOURS must exceed the longest legit provisioning window (currently 6).
# Never point SWEEP_TARGET_ENV at prod from a dev checkout.
# The sweeper needs the Ledgerbin control-plane credential to issue deletes, and that secret is set on the very next line.

vault entry, hahaf-tafog: VAULT_KEY3=38a

**Action item (Maplewright incident 2024-Q3):** EXIF scrubbing must run before thumbnails are generated, not after, since thumbnailers can copy GPS tags forward. New team members: the scrubber's tag allowlist, worker pool size, and timeout are deliberately conservative — change them only with a reviewed ticket. The current tuning constants appear below.

tuning constants:
QUOTAS = {
    "druwyn": 5,
    "holix": 5,
    "zorath": 5,
    "holwyn": 10,
}

Action item from the Pinefold kiosk outage: the watchdog restarted the shell but not the payment daemon, so kiosks looked healthy while declining every card. Fix is to make the watchdog supervise the full process group and alert on partial restarts. Owner assigned; due next sprint. Watchdog config details are documented here.

runbook for badug-kadup: https://confluence.zemvarlabs.internal/projects/browse/display/projects/bd1b

**Mgmt Meeting Minutes — Retiring the Brightline Range**

Quick recap for sales leads at Fenholt Supplies: we agreed to retire the Brightline fixture range by year-end. Remaining stock moves to clearance pricing next month, and accounts on standing orders get migrated to the Lumetta range. Trade-in incentives were approved in principle. The confidential note on next steps sits just below.

board note of bajof-bajeg: The pricing group signed off on a budget of $13.4 million for Project Sildor. The renewal with Lamixek Holdings closes at $48.9 million a year, 49 percent above the last contract.